Cybersecurity engineering for real-world application.

This on-campus or 100% online Master of Science in CyberSecurity Engineering (MS-CSE) program emphasizes ethics, applied and theoretical technical knowledge and skills, cross-domain learning and a mission-centric focus — essential training for the information security practitioners (public or private) who protect the prosperity and safety of companies, communities and the nation. The information security graduate program is academically rigorous, focusing on the engineering aspects of software and hardware security. It has been designed with working professionals in mind, offering courses either completely on campus or completely online.
